Ordinals
beta
Sat 1329517188045159
decimal
321806.2188045159
degree
0°111806′1262″2188045159‴
percentile
63.31034235750612%
name
ekwnwribhug
cycle
0
epoch
1
period
159
block
321806
offset
2188045159
timestamp
2014-09-21 05:28:02 UTC
rarity
common
prev
next